Hearing to consider amendments to the San Mateo County Ordinance Code in connection with the existing chapter entitled Stables as follows: | |
1) |
Certifying that the Negative Declaration is complete, correct and prepared in accordance with the California Environmental Quality Act | ||
2) |
Adoption of an ordinance amending the Code to replace the existing Division 6, Part 4, Chapter 1 entitled Stables with the proposed chapter entitled Confined Animal Regulations, and waiver of reading the ordinance in its entirety | ||
3) |
Adoption of an ordinance amending multiple sections of Chapter 20 of the Code deleting existing terms for the keeping of horses and adding the term keeping of confined animals, and waiver of reading the ordinance in its entirety | ||
4) |
Adoption of an ordinance amending Division 6, Part 1, Chapter 4 of the Code to allow abatement of a non-conforming confined animal use, structure or situation shown to degrade water quality or sensitive habitats, and waiver of reading the ordinance in its entirety | ||
5) |
Adoption of an ordinance amending Division 7, Chapter 2 of the Code to establish an exemption to building permit requirements for small confined animal structures, and waiver of reading the ordinance in its entirety | ||
6) |
Resolution amending the planning service fee schedule to add a confined animal permit fee |
7) |
Resolution directing staff to submit to the California Coastal Commission a set of Local Coastal Program zoning amendments establishing confined animal regulations (Environmental Services Agency Director) |
